M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015 Routledge.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
book
which
reviews
subjects
having to do with open
education resources
(OERs) and
massively open online courses (MOOCs).
The latest
evolvements in
elearning enable
learners
all around the world
to be participants in online classes.
Massively open online courses are
almost always free
for learners but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
